Re: webcam fails to startup after PC restart

Just to close this issue.
I resolved it by changing the Capture Pallet from Auto to a non auto setting YUV. Not sure what YUV it was but avoiding the auto setting fixed the startup issue. Now both local webcams startup every time. Happy days.
